The show consistently centers faith, scripture, and practical living, often blending personal stories with spiritual guidance. Episodes range from biblical reflections on anxiety, modesty, and body image to faith-driven wellness, digital disciplines, and testimony-sharing, all with an approachable, youth-friendly tone. A notable strength is how faith informs everyday choices—fitness, social media use, relationships, and goal-setting—while keeping conversations hopeful and actionable for listeners navigating modern life with their faith.
